The Diablo 4 minimum requirements are pretty tame by modern standards, achieving a respectable performance on hardware as old as an AMD R9 280 or Nvidia GeForce GTX 660 GPU, 8GB of RAM, and a decade-old CPU like the Intel Core i5 2500K or AMD FX 8350. However, as can be expected of such ancient hardware, you'll only be able to achieve, at best, 30fps at 720p on the "Low" graphics preset.

Interestingly, Blizzard states you might be able to get the game to run on hardware below this specification, as they infer the game will try its best to run on HDDs, dual-core CPUs, and integrated GPUs.

Rendering the major regions of Sanctuary with the Diablo 4 recommended specs doesn't call for much hardware, with the developers stating you only need an Nvidia GeForce GTX 970 and AMD Radeon RX 470 graphics card. As far as processors go, you'll need an Intel Core i5-4670K or AMD Ryzen 1300X coupled with 16GB of RAM. This will, however, only net you 60fps at 1080p on the "Medium" graphics preset.

If you want to enjoy the best Diablo 4 settings, you'll start needing some heftier hardware to meet the Diablo 4 high requirements. An Nvidia RTX 2060 or AMD RX 5700 XT graphics card paired with either an Intel Core i7 8700K or AMD Ryzen 2700X processor will get you up and running at 60 frames per second at 1080p on the "High" graphics preset. Yet, surprisingly, this isn't actually enough to get the game running with ray tracing enabled unless you're willing to lower the reflections and shadows settings, turn off foliage and particles, and anticipate 30fps performance. You might manage to achieve 60fps on a 1440p monitor with this level of hardware, but you may have to drop down to medium settings.

Blizzard cranks up the hardware heat with the Diablo 4 ultra requirements, calling for the power of the RTX 40 series, RTX 3080, and AMD RX 6800 XT graphics cards to achieve full 4K resolution on the "Ultra" graphics preset at 60fps. In conjunction with one of the best graphics card options, you'll also need an Intel Core i7 8700K or AMD Ryzen 7 2700X CPU and 32GB of the best gaming RAM to meet the ultra specs. That said, if you are looking to enable ray tracing, you'll want to take advantage of the full Nvidia DLSS 3 suite, including Super Resolution and Frame Generation with the RTX 4080. The GeForce tools can boost fps further than ever using the power of AI upscaling, and it could make all the difference if you're aiming for sky-high frame rates.

There's no mention of Intel Arc cards, unfortunately. However, team blue claims that the Intel Arc A770 is more than capable of hitting over 100fps with XeSS enabled.

The Diablo 4 download size is what you'd expect of a AAA game, requiring 90GB of SSD space to install the game. Technically, HDDs are compatible and can run the game with major settings downgrades, but you certainly won't benefit from the performance of one of our best SSD for gaming picks if you're still rocking a rickety old hard drive.
